When it comes to power source, you have two main options: electric or battery-operated. Electric window cleaning machines are typically more powerful and are ideal for heavy-duty cleaning jobs. However, they require access to an electrical outlet, which may not always be convenient. Battery-operated machines, on the other hand, are more portable and can be used in areas without electricity. Consider which option is best for your needs and choose a machine accordingly.

One highly recommended window cleaning machine is the Karcher WV5 Plus Non-Stop Cleaning Kit. This machine is cordless, lightweight, and easy to use, making it ideal for both home and professional use. It comes with a built-in squeegee and spray bottle, as well as adjustable settings for different cleaning tasks. The WV5 Plus is also designed to be streak-free, leaving your windows sparkling clean every time.

Another popular option is the Unger Stingray Indoor Window Cleaning Kit. This machine is designed for indoor use and features a 3-in-1 cleaning system that includes a spray bottle, microfiber cleaning pad, and scrubbing brush. The Stingray is ideal for small to medium-sized windows and is particularly effective at removing dirt and grime.
